Benzene is produced by catalytic hydrodealkylation of toluene: CH3CH3 + H2 CH + CH4 2 C6H6 C12H10 + H2 The reactor's outlet consisting of the products (Benzene and methane), the unreacted hydrogen and toluene, and by-product biphenyl is separated into four products, H2/methane, Benzene, Toluene, and biphenyl, using a series of distillation columns. a) (20 Points) Label each of the four product streams in the provided sequence. b) (40 Points) If each component's recovery in its corresponding stream is 95%, estimate the composition of each product stream in kmol/h. State any made assumptions. c) (20 Points). Draw a better distillation sequence and explain why it is better than the provided sequence. Flow Rate, kmol/h Hydrogen 500 Methane 2000 Benzene 400 Toluene 100 Biphenyl 25 CL
